What Is SEO?

SEO, or Search Engine Optimization, is the process of improving a website so it can rank higher in search engine results. The goal is to attract more visitors who are searching for products, services, or information related to a business.

A strong SEO strategy can help startups increase website traffic and reach potential customers more effectively.

Why SEO Matters for Startups

Many startups have limited marketing budgets. SEO allows businesses to attract visitors without paying for every click or advertisement.

By investing in SEO, startups can build brand awareness, increase website traffic, and create a sustainable source of leads over time.

Keyword Research

Keyword research helps startups understand what people are searching for online. By targeting relevant keywords, businesses can create content that matches user interests and improves search visibility.

Many startups use keyword research to identify opportunities and attract the right audience to their websites.

Content Marketing

Creating high-quality content is an important part of SEO. Blog post, guides, and educational resources can help startups attract visitors and establish authority in their industry.

Consistently publishing useful content can improve search ranking and increase organic traffic over time. AI is also changing the way businesses create and optimize content for search engines.

On-Page SEO

On-page SEO involves optimizing website content, headings, images, and page structure. These improvements help search engines understand the content and improve the user experience.

Startups that focus on on-page SEO can make their websites more accessible and easier to navigate.

Common SEO Mistakes Startups Should Avoid

Many startups expect SEO results immediately, but SEO is a long-term strategy. Common mistakes include publishing low-quality content, ignoring keyword research, and failing to update website content regularly.

By avoiding these mistakes, startups can build a stronger online presence and improve their chances of ranking higher in search results.
